漏洞影响范围: 5.0.0-5.0.23 官方已在5.0.24版本修复该漏洞。测试Payload: 以某个网站为例,可以看到成功执行phpinfo()函数。 ...
分类:
Web程序 时间:
2019-07-20 21:42:09
阅读次数:
590
thinkphp的CURD中,使用save方法时会出现一个奇怪的问题,即如果数据没有更新(与原数据相同),返回值判断为false。其实很久之前就发现了这个问题,一度以为是官方代码的问题,但是一直拖延到最近才想到要去解决这个问题。不得不说:“明日复明日,明日何其多。事事待明日,万事皆蹉跎。”,与君共勉 ...
分类:
其他好文 时间:
2019-07-20 21:24:11
阅读次数:
198
1、让Runtime下的文件格式化:入口文件处:define('STRIP_RUNTIME_SPACE',false); 2、开发时不进行缓存:入口文件处:define('NO_CACHE_RUNTIME',true); 3、ThinkPHP支持四种访问模式:a:普通模式 b:pathinfo模式 ...
分类:
Web程序 时间:
2019-07-19 19:03:17
阅读次数:
131
1.可以通过修改配置文件的 default_return_type修改输出类型 2. 可以通过Config类设置输出类型 ...
分类:
Web程序 时间:
2019-07-18 13:23:16
阅读次数:
697
一.入口模块修改 修改public下的index 加入 define('BIND_MODULE','admin'); 即可将入门模块绑定到admin模块 二.路由美化 1.开启路由配置 2.在conf目录新建 route.php 3.助手函数 url()直接修改url ...
分类:
Web程序 时间:
2019-07-17 09:13:07
阅读次数:
147
一.application 应用目录 controller 控制器 view 视图 model 模型 1.admin目录 后天模块 1.index目录 前台模块 3.command.php 命令行配置文件 当用命令行执行thinkphp时 会读取command.php的配置 4.common.php ...
分类:
Web程序 时间:
2019-07-15 01:05:48
阅读次数:
128
环境:ubuntu php7.2 phpstorm https://blog.csdn.net/roukmanx/article/details/85646174 https://www.kancloud.cn/manual/thinkphp5/118006 安装首先安装apache2、php7.0 ...
分类:
Web程序 时间:
2019-07-14 23:54:43
阅读次数:
289
1 到这里下载classes里面的文件 https://github.com/PHPOffice/PHPExcel 2 然后放到 thinkphp的vendor 新建一个文件夹 Phpexcel 然后把文件放进去 3 在封装一个函数 4 然后调用这个函数 5 然后结果的样子 ...
分类:
Web程序 时间:
2019-07-14 00:11:48
阅读次数:
156
登录界面: 数据库和数据表的结构 具体的操作步骤如下: 第一步:入口文件index.php内容 (此文件基本是属于固定的格式) <?phpdefine('THINK_PATH','./ThinkPHP/');define('APP_NAME','MyApp');define('APP_PAHT',' ...
分类:
Web程序 时间:
2019-07-12 09:29:38
阅读次数:
114
1.TP框架基础 1.1目录结构 1.2配置文件 1.框架主配置文件(惯例配置文件) thinkphp/convention.php 2. 应用公共配置文件 application/config.php, application/database.php 对整个应用生效 3.模块配置文件 appli ...
分类:
Web程序 时间:
2019-07-05 22:45:56
阅读次数:
231